1: 2012-05-13 (日) 08:32:17 なーお ソース 2: 2012-05-13 (日) 10:38:41 なーお ソース
Deleted an attach file: install_finish.jpg at 2012-05-13 (日) 09:56:30 at 2012-05-13 (日) 10:12:40
Line 1: Line 1:
** xupdateとは? [#w5eedd3b] ** xupdateとは? [#w5eedd3b]
xupdateは、XCL (Xoops Cube Legacy) 2.2 以降で動作するモジュールで、モジュールやテーマのインストールやアップデートをFTPクライアントを使わずに迅速に行うことが可能になる、ユーティリティ系モジュールです。 xupdateは、XCL (Xoops Cube Legacy) 2.2 以降で動作するモジュールで、モジュールやテーマのインストールやアップデートをFTPクライアントを使わずに迅速に行うことが可能になる、ユーティリティ系モジュールです。
 +
 +** 動作要件 [#e0d343aa]
 +xupdateを使うためには、以下の環境が必須または推奨となります。
 +- PHP 5.2.0以上 (必須)
 +-- safeモードで無いこと (ほぼ必須:GitHubからのダウンロード)
 +-- cURLエクステンション (必須)
 +-- zip 拡張関数:--enable-zipでphpがコンパイルされている (必須)
 +- MySQL 5.0 以上 (必須)
 +- Xoops Cube legacy 2.2.0 以上
 +
 +** 対象モジュール・テーマ [#d9972c90]
 +#region(Xoops X (ten) ストア管理モジュール){{
 +[bulletin]:ユーザが自由にコメントできる、<br/>スラッシュドット風のニュースモジュール
 +[cubeUtils]:マルチ言語とログイン拡張用モジュール
 +[d3forum]:コメント統合機能が秀逸なXOOPSフォーラムモジュール、
 +[d3pipes]:RSS等のシンジケーションを自由自在に扱うためのモジュール
 +[gnavi]:GoogleMapを用いたエリアガイド作成モジュール
 +[myalbum-p]:XOOPS内でPhotoアルバムを作れるモジュールです
 +[multiMenu]:Xoopsに自由なマルチメニューを表示する
 +[none]:「特に何もしない」noneモジュールの、テンプレート強化版
 +[piCal]:カレンダーモジュール
 +[pico]:静的コンテンツ作成モジュール
 +[search]:xoopsコアのsearchの代替モジュール
 +[xpress]:ブログツール wordpress を XoopsCube 上で使えるモジュール
 +[xsns]:SNSをXOOPS内で立ち上げることができるモジュールです
 +[xupdate]:xupdateモジュール自身
 +}}
 +#region(naao GitHub ストア管理モジュール){{
 +[d3diary]:簡単に使えて、友人機能との連携や記事単位の権限設定など高機能の日記モジュールです
 +}}
 +#region(domifara  ストア管理モジュール){{
 +[xugjmcdel]:xugj_assign のメニューキャッシュを削除するモジュール
 +[myckeditor]:CKEditorとファイルマネージャー by domifara
 +[chalog]シンプルなブログモジュール XCL日本語専用
 +}}
 +#region(HypWeb GitHub ストア管理モジュール){{
 +[HypCommon]:携帯やスマホ対応、スパム対策などを可能とするHypCommonFunc 本体と関連の設定
 +[xpwiki]:PukiWikiベースのWikiモジュール。hypconfを先にインストールしておきます。
 +[xelfinder]:ファイルマネージャー elfinder for xoops from GitHub。セーフモードではGitHubからは取得できません。
 +}}
 +#region(xoops123 ストア管理テーマ){{
 +[fashion_a]
 +[fashion]
 +[photograph]
 +[basic5]
 +[basic5a]
 +[magazine]
 +[4seasons]:1月~12月の、月毎のテーマを自動的に表示します。
 +[January]
 +[February]
 +[March]
 +[April]
 +[May]
 +[June]
 +[July]
 +[August]
 +[September]
 +[October]
 +[November]
 +[December]
 +[simple]
 +[vgrid2]
 +[vgrid]
 +[momiji]
 +[sakura]
 +[colors4x]
 +[colors3x]
 +[colors2x]
 +[colors2]
 +[colors]
 +}}
 +
 +** 使い方 [#h94707aa]
 +
 +*** ダウンロード [#ke15dcd4]
 +GitHubのXoopsX配布リポジトリ群の中にあり、以下のURLで最新のスナップショットソースをダウンロードできます。 最終的に、Xoops X (ten) パッケージに同梱され、2ndインストーラで導入推奨モジュールとなる予定です。
 +https://github.com/XoopsX/xupdate/downloads
 +
 +*** 展開とサーバーへのアップロード [#h714d9bc]
 +zipまたはtar.gzお好みのアーカイブでダウンロードし、解凍・展開ののち、d3モジュールなど複製対応モジュールと同様に、 html配下(htmlフォルダは含まず)を、サーバー上のxoopsインストールでxoops_rooth_pathに設定されたフォルダ内に。xoops_trust_path配下を同じくxoops_trust_path内にアップロードします。
 +
 +*** インストール [#f4cd5a24]
 +xupdateのインストールは、通常のxoops cubeモジュールのインストールと同様です。
 +
 +*** 一般設定 [#feb546b4]
 +CENTER:&ref(preference.jpg,mw:480,mh:360);
 +- 圧縮ファイルダウンロード・展開用フォルダ
 +アーカイブをダウンロードして展開するために使用するフォルダ。(xoops_trust_path)配下のディレクトリを指定、最初と最後の"/"(スラッシュ)は含めません。通常は、uploads/xupdate のままでご使用ください。
 +このフォルダには、707,777 などの書き込み権限を与えてください。
 +
 +- 使用するFTPライブラリ
 +サーバーにファイル群をアップロードする際に使用するFTPライブラリの選択。カスタムFTP(標準)を選択して問題が解決できない場合、
 +PHP_FTP(FTP over SSL用)や、カスタムSSH_FTPをお試しください。
 +-- カスタムFTP(標準)
 +PHPにFTP関数が実装されていない場合は、まずはこのカスタムFTPを選択します。
 +-- PHP_FTP(FTPS用)
 +PHPにFTP関数が実装されている場合は、こちらも選択できます。 サーバーがFTPSでの転送をサポートする場合は、これを選択して、次項でSSL(FTPS)を設定します。
 +-- カスタムSSH_FTP
 +サーバーがSSHの使用をサポートしている場合、標準のカスタムFTPよりもこちらの方が高速に動作する場合があります。
 +
 +- SSL(FTPS)を使用する
 +前項で「PHP_FTP(FTPS用)」を指定した場合に、SSL(FTPS)が使用可能です。
 +
 +- FTPログインID/FTPログインパスワード
 +ご使用のサーバーの、FTPログインIDとパスワードを入力します。
 +
 +- デバグ出力を表示する
 +問題が解決しない場合は、ここを「はい」とすることで、追加デバグ情報が表示されます。
 +- テーマURL
 +CMS Theme Finder のURLで、通常は変更不要です。
 +
 +*** 動作チェック [#db76aebf]
 +CENTER:&ref(check_NG.jpg,mw:480,mh:360);
 +展開フォルダの権限設定が不適切だったり、FTPログイン設定が間違っていると、上のように赤字で表示されます。 下のように緑色表示になると正常ですので、設定を見直してください。
 +CENTER:&ref(check_OK.jpg,mw:480,mh:360);
 +
 +*** モジュール [#d770db2f]
 +- 「モジュール」タブを選択すると、モジュール一覧表示になります。
 +CENTER:&ref(module_list.jpg,mw:480,mh:360);
 +- 「操作」のアイコンをクリックすると、インストール・またはアップデート画面に移ります。
 +CENTER:&ref(install_confirm.jpg,mw:480,mh:360);
 +- 「インストール」をクリックすると、アーカイブのダウンロード・展開・サーバーへのFTPでの配置が行われます。
 +CENTER:&ref(install_finish.jpg,mw:480,mh:360);
 +- 「インストール」をクリックして、通常のモジュールインストールに進みます。
 +CENTER:&ref(install_install.jpg,mw:480,mh:360);
 +
 +**** ディレクトリ名の変更 [#pb725f6a]
 +d3モジュールなど、複製対応モジュールはモジュール名(ディレクトリ名)が変更可能です。
 +- まず、「モジュール名」を編集し、「モジュール名編集」ボタンで送信
 +CENTER:&ref(dirname_edit.jpg,mw:480,mh:360);
 +- 確認画面で確認し、「アップデート」
 +CENTER:&ref(dirname_confirm.jpg,mw:480,mh:360);
 +- 編集が保存されるので、インストールに進みます。 元のモジュール名の行が追加されていますので、同様に追加インストールやモジュール名変更操作が可能です。
 +CENTER:&ref(dirname_install.jpg,mw:480,mh:360);
 +
 +*** テーマ [#bce2c691]
 +テーマも、モジュールと同様の手順でインストールが可能です。 テーマ名の変更・複製はできません。
 +
 +*** テーマファインダ [#haec4743]
 +[[CMS Theme Finder:http://cmsthemefinder.com/]]に登録されているテーマをダウンロード・インストールできます。


トップ   差分 バックアップ 複製 名前変更 リロード印刷に適した表示   ページ新規作成 全ページ一覧 単語検索 最新ページの一覧   ヘルプ   最新ページのRSS 1.0 最新ページのRSS 2.0 最新ページのRSS Atom Powered by xpWiki
Counter: 3701, today: 1, yesterday: 38